Meeting held to follow up work of Joint Syrian-Russian Governmental Committee in Moscow

Moscow, SANA- In parallel to the summit held between Presidents Bashar al-Assad and Vladimir Putin, a meeting was held to follow up the work of the Joint Syrian-Russian Governmental Committee co-chaired by Mansour Azzam, Minister of Presidential Affairs, Chairman of the Committee on the Syrian side, and Yury Borisov, Deputy Prime Minister and Chairman of the Committee on the Russian side.

During the meeting, a deep evaluation of the formulas and projects of economic cooperation between the two friendly countries was conducted, as well as a discussion of a number of joint agreements and projects in the fields of agriculture, industry, energy, water and information technology, in addition to the measures taken with the aim of facilitating and enhancing trade exchange between the two countries, emphasizing the pivotal role of the business sector in the two countries in this field.

The talks also dealt with the reality and prospects of providing the appropriate environment to encourage joint investments in projects that create added values in the interest of the two friendly countries and peoples, and the ongoing preparations for holding the thirteenth session of the Governmental Committee, where the two sides expressed their satisfaction with the efforts made in the framework of developing economic relations.
